Figure 4. Intracerebroventricular TOMA effects on tau pathology in P301L. Representative epifluorescence images of the CA1 region of 8-month-old P301L mice intracerebroventricularly immunized with TOMA or nonspecific IgG antibody (anti-rhodamine), immunostained with Thr231-green (A, D), T22-red (B, E), and merged + DAPI (C, F). A, Strong immunoreactivity with Thr231 in the perikaryon (solid white arrows) and neuronal processes (solid yellow arrows) of control IgG-treated mice compared with TOMA-treated mice (open white and yellow arrows; D). B, Tau oligomers as detected by T22 in somata (solid white arrows) and neuronal processes (solid yellow arrows) of IgG-treated mice. E, TOMA reduced tau oligomers in the perikaryon (open white arrows), neuronal processes (open yellow arrows), and the perinuclear area (asterisks). Scale bar, 15 μm. G–L, Quantification of changes observed in brain sections of frontal cortex from 8-month-old P301L mice immunized with TOMA and P301L mice injected with control IgG and immunostained with Thr231, T22, and HT7. G–I, Percentage of total immunoreactivity in cell bodies in the dentate gyrus. Shown is the reduction of Thr231 (G), T22 (H), and HT7 (I) immunoreactivity in cell bodies of mice immunized with TOMA compared with control mice. ★p < 0.02; ★p < 0.05; ★p < 0.02, respectively; Student's t test. J–L, Percentage of the immunoreactivity in neuronal processes in CA1 from P301L mice treated with TOMA and control mice. Reduction of Thr231 (J) and T22 (K) immunoreactivity in the TOMA group compared with the control group. ★p < 0.01; ★★p < 0.003. L, Significant increase in HT7 (specific for human tau) immunoreactivity in the TOMA-treated mice compared with control mice. ★p < 0.04. Bars represent the means and error bars the SEM, unpaired Student's t test. The levels of tau oligomers and monomers in mouse brain homogenates were assessed by Western blot using Tau-5, AT100, and AT180. M, Western blot of PBS soluble fraction from brain homogenate of mice immunized with the nonspecific IgG antibody (lanes 1–4) and mice immunized with TOMA (lanes 5–8) detected with Tau-5 antibody and reprobed with AT100 and AT180. Internal control is shown at the bottom. N, Graphs represent the relative band intensity for AT100 and AT180 (arbitrary units, AU). The differences were statistically significant. ★★p < 0.005; ★p < 0.02, Student's t test, respectively. Bars represent means and error bars SEM.
